Company Description
Cisco is a company that specializes in networking technologies, particularly Internet Protocol (IP)-based solutions. It was established in 1984 by a group of computer scientists from Stanford University. As of today, Cisco has a global workforce, continuing to innovate in various fields, notably in routing and switching. Adding to its core business, the company also delves into emerging technologies including home networking, IP telephony, optical networking, security features, storage area networking, and wireless technology. Moreover, Cisco extends its expertise to offer a sweeping range of services such as technical support and advanced services. The company sells its products and services on an enterprise level, to commercial businesses, service providers, and end-users.

Cisco Nexus are a huge stable solution with Cisco lack of marketing
Cisco Nexus portfolio has a huge of products depending on the business requirements for mid or big company size. Cisco Nexus has a lot of functionalities and can work in two modes or OS: NX-OS for standard deployments and ACI for SDN into the Datacenter. For us this works very well because we can use one of them according to our needs. - NETWORK SECURITY ENGINEER50M-1B USDIT ServicesReview Source

Cisco Nexus Switches: A Powerhouse for Large Scale Datacenter Deployments
Cisco Nexus switches are one of the best series for large scale datacenter deployments. These switches offer security, scalability, and high performance for low latency east-west traffic. Newer models like N9K's can be deployed in Nexus or ACI mode.
